### Step 4: Point plugins at the sharded profile store

With Carthport's user-profile store now split across four shards, plugin authors must stop issuing direct table reads. Route all lookups through the shard-aware gateway, which hashes on profile ID. Cross-shard scans are disabled; use the export API instead. Before testing, apply the gateway configuration values shown below.

service settings:
PRAIX_LOG_LEVEL=error
PRAIX_METRICS_HOST=metrics.praix.qorvelcorp.corp
PRAIX_POOL_SIZE=16

Welcome to the Pipsqueak deploy-status bot wiki. Quick heads up on quotas: the bot rate-limits its own replies so it doesn't flood the #releases channel during a big rollout train. Don't raise these without pinging the platform crew first — the chat gateway will throttle us hard. Current limits and backoff settings are as follows.

tuning constants:
QUOTAS = {
    "druwyn": 5,
    "holix": 5,
    "zorath": 5,
    "holwyn": 10,
}

Handover: Spokeshift rebalancing tool. The nightly job ranks Vellmore stations by dock deficit and emails the van crews a route. If support gets complaints about empty stations, check the job log first — usually a stale inventory feed. Restarting the feed poller fixes it. For anything beyond that, contact the tool owner named below.

named custodian: Brivan Eliath Quenox Frador

14:22 — Offline sync regression confirmed (Terrapath field-survey app)

At 14:22 the on-call engineer reproduced the data-loss path: surveys saved while offline were marked synced once connectivity returned, even when the upload was rejected. The queue flush skipped the server acknowledgement check introduced in the previous sprint. Release manager note: the fix must ship before the coastal survey season. The offending build is identified by the token recorded below.

session token of kawif-fawig = htk31_f3f599be2b1a34affb1efa8d0feccf8